FYI, recently released disk drives on the market may include an onboard 32-byte hardware RNG that can provide bits to the host for its own use upon request via the usual command channel per TCG Opal Storage Specifications. http://www.trustedcomputinggroup.org/files/resource_files/B15F1F8F-1A4B-B294-D03F09D5122B21F6/Opal_SSC_2%2000_rev1%2000_final.pdf
